在本篇文章中,我們將學習如何使用Arduino開發板製作一個簡易的機械臂(Robot Arm),可以使用定製的Android應用程序進行無線控制和編程。我將向您展示製作的整個過程,從設計和3D打印機器人部件,到連接電子元件和編程Arduino,以及開發我們自己的Android應用程序來控制機械臂。
簡介
使用應用程序中的滑塊,我們可以手動控制機械臂的每個伺服或軸的運動。使用“保存”按鈕,我們可以記錄每個位置或步驟,然後機器人手臂可以自動運行並重復這些步驟。使用同一個按鈕,我們可以暫停自動操作以及重置或刪除所有步驟,以便我們可以記錄新的步驟。
Arduino機械臂的3D模型
首先,我使用Solidworks 3D建模軟件設計了機械臂的模型。機械臂有5個自由度。
對於前面的3個軸:腰部、肩部和肘部,使用的是MG996R伺服電機,而另外2個軸,腕部滾動和腕部間距,以及夾具我使用了較小的SG90微型伺服電機。
3D打印機械臂
我使用的3D打印機型號是Creality CR-10,通過這個設備,我3D打印了Arduino機械臂的所有部件。
在這裏,我想向Banggood.com致謝,爲我提供這款超棒的3D打印機。 Creality CR-10的打印質量令人驚歎,其價格也非常出色,它的預裝配率接近90%。
更多內容請參考以下鏈接:https://www.yiboard.com/thread-983-1-1.html